mirror of
https://github.com/element-hq/synapse.git
synced 2024-11-26 03:25:53 +03:00
1b09b0832e
```py @trace @tag_args async def get_oldest_event_ids_with_depth_in_room(...) ... ``` Before this PR, you would see a warning in the logs and the span was not exported: ``` 2022-08-03 19:11:59,383 - synapse.logging.opentracing - 835 - ERROR - GET-0 - @trace may not have wrapped EventFederationWorkerStore.get_oldest_event_ids_with_depth_in_room correctly! The function is not async but returned a coroutine. ```
1 line
83 B
Text
1 line
83 B
Text
Allow use of both `@trace` and `@tag_args` stacked on the same function (tracing).
|